Liam Gallagher Suffers From Tinnitus, Just Like Brother Noel














Liam Gallagher is plagued by tinnitus, the hearing condition that torments his brother Noel.

The Beady Eye frontman has suffered from a constant ringing in his lugholes for years – down to fronting mega-loud Oasis gigs.

Noel visited doctors, who gave him a brain scan before the diagnosis. But Liam isn’t bothered about a check-up.

Speaking after an acoustic gig at London’s Rough Trade East store to launch Beady Eye’s new album BE, Liam revealed: “Without a doubt I have tinnitus. You’re not a proper rock ‘n’ roll star if you don’t.

“I learned to live with it a long time ago. I put up with it – I just talk really loudly over it.

“I’m proud of it. Anyone who doesn’t have ringing in their ears can f*** right off.”

Asked what he thought of Noel’s doctor visit, he sneered: “Each to his own I suppose. He’s got f*** all else to do, hasn’t he?”

BE is up against a record by the ear-shattering Black Sabbath this week, with both tipped for the top.
